check your router DNS setup, try this those addresses 

> 208.67.222.222 (primary)

> 208.67.220.220 (secondary)

and the same for you NIC config.

try to ping to an IP adress ie: 66.102.9.103 (this is google one) to see if this is a DNS related problem.